Project in KTM land swap to go on despite dispute over development charges

Malaysia Star, 18 Sep 2011
SINGAPORE: Malaysia and Singa­pore do not expect any delay in developing the parcels of land in the republic that both sides had agreed to despite a dispute be­tween them regarding charges to be imposed for the development.
Both countries are expected to take this dispute to the Permanent Court of Arbitration for a decision.
